The Nocturnal Playmate

Friday, July 11th, 2008

Sugar gliders are docile creatures during the day. They nap, eat, and sometimes exercise. However, the real fun begins when the sun goes down. These little creatures love to roam around and play at night, which is perfectly normal for those owners who begin to worry. It may even help you [...]
